Savory Meat Loaf Sandwiches |
|
 |
Prep Time: 15 Minutes Cook Time: 0 Minutes |
Ready In: 15 Minutes Servings: 14 |
|
My philosophy is that life's too short to eat bland, boring foods, so I created this recipe. With salsa and cayenne pepper, these sandwiches pack a little punch. Ingredients:
1/2 cup salsa |
1 tablespoon worcestershire sauce |
1/8 teaspoon salt |
1/8 teaspoon cayenne pepper |
1/8 teaspoon pepper |
1/2 cup diced sharp cheddar cheese |
1/2 cup diced swiss cheese |
1/2 cup chopped dill pickle |
1 can (2-1/4 ounces) sliced ripe olives, drained |
1/3 cup chopped red onion |
1/3 cup dry bread crumbs |
1 egg |
3 tablespoons crumbled blue cheese |
2 pounds bulk pork sausage |
14 to 16 hard rolls, split |
dijon mustard |
Directions:
1. In a large bowl, combine the first five ingredients. Add the next eight ingredients; mix well. Add the sausage; mix well. Press into an ungreased 9-in. x 5-in. loaf pan. 2. Bake at 350° for 1 hour; drain often. Increase temperature to 375° and bake 30 minutes longer or until a thermometer reads 160°; drain. 3. Cool in pan for 30 minutes. Remove from pan; cover and chill overnight. Cut into 1/2-in.-thick slices. Spread rolls with mustard and top with meat loaf slices. Yield: 14-16 servings. |
